The protocol combines Peer-to-Contract (P2C) lending pools and Peer-to-Peer (P2P) lending markets, appealing to a diverse spectrum of investors.
The P2C model serves conservative investors focused on steady returns, facilitating loans in high-value assets like Bitcoin (BTC) and Ethereum (ETH). In contrast, the P2P lending market allows for flexible terms among users, particularly for more speculative tokens, thus unlocking liquidity for holders of high-risk assets. Another pivotal aspect of Mutuum Finance is its decentralized stablecoin, which anchors the platform’s ecosystem. Designed to maintain a $1 peg, this stablecoin operates on an overcollateralization model, ensuring safety and fluidity in transactions. By minting stablecoins when users lock in quality collateral and burning them upon loan repayments, Mutuum Finance secures a reliable medium of exchange.
